Public Service Ministry launches three policies

Government through the Ministry of Public Services (MPG) has launched three transformative policy documents on Monday. They are the Monitoring, Evaluation, Accountability, and Learning (MEAL) Framework, the Gender Equality and Social Inclusion (GESI) Policy, and the Solomon Islands Public Service Transformation Strategy. Rising mental cases in Western province

Between three to four new mental cases involving youths are being recorded each week at the Gizo’s Hospital Mental Health Unit, Western Province. This alarming rate highlights the increasing trend of mental illness cases in the province, with the majority of patients being young people between the ages of 15 and 35. According to figures…

Crackdown on sales of pharmacy drugs

Auki police have cracked an alleged network of pharmacy theft of drugs from the Kilu’ufi Provincial Hospital on Malaita. The case seems to confirm widespread suspicion that drugs from the Government Pharmacy store being stolen and sold to shops and individuals, often depriving the National Referral Hospital of live-saving drugs.
